Binary tree preorder calculator

WebThere are three types of depth first traversals: Pre-Order Traversal: We first visit the root, then the the left subtree and right subtree. In-Order Traversal: We first visit the left … A data structure visualizer This Project is Open sourced!!, visit our github to contribute github to contribute WebA binary expression tree is a binary tree that stores a binary expression ... Performing a preorder traversal of a binary expression tree and recording the node contents produces the "prefix form" of the expression stored in the tree. ... the calculator would build a suitable binary expression tree to hold the expression, and use this ...

Binary Tree: Pre-order Traversal - Medium

WebSep 7, 2024 · Breadth-First Search (also Level Order) This one is a little more tricky and can only be done using a queue. It might be possible with recursion but it's easier to understand iteratively. It uses a queue when traversing so it goes through the tree as nodes are added to it. As a result, it goes through the tree, level by level. WebTree Traversal Methods. In-order. Pre-order. Post-order (Must read: Python to represent output) Binary Tree . Binary trees are simple trees that can have at most two children, … bitbucket ldap configuration file https://andermoss.com

Binary tree - Wikipedia

WebTree Traversal - inorder, preorder and postorder. In this tutorial, you will learn about different tree traversal techniques. Also, you will find working examples of different tree traversal methods in C, C++, Java and Python. WebDec 1, 2024 · Detailed solution for Preorder Traversal of Binary Tree - Problem Statement: Given a binary tree print the preorder traversal of binary tree. Example: Solution: Disclaimer: Don't jump directly to the solution, try it out yourself first. Solution 1: Iterative Intuition: In preorder traversal, the tree is traversed in this way: root, left, right. … WebAnimation Speed: w: h: Algorithm Visualizations bitbucket link to image

Binary Search Tree (BST) Traversals – Inorder, Preorder, …

Category:Binary Search Tree Visualization - University of San Francisco

Tags:Binary tree preorder calculator

Binary tree preorder calculator

Number of Nodes in a Binary Tree With Level N - Baeldung

WebTraverse the following binary tree by using pre-order traversal. Since, the traversal scheme, we are using is pre-order traversal, therefore, the first element to be printed is 18. traverse the left sub-tree recursively. The root node of … WebApr 12, 2024 · Solution: Following is a 3 step solution for converting Binary tree to Binary Search Tree. Create a temp array arr [] that stores inorder traversal of the tree. This step …

Binary tree preorder calculator

Did you know?

WebInorder + Preorder to Binary Tree. Now, let us construct tree from given Inorder and Preorder Traversals. Let us assume that the Inorder Sequence is [4, 2, 5, 1, 6, 3] … WebAnimation Speed: w: h: Algorithm Visualizations

WebJan 26, 2024 · For Preorder, you traverse from the root to the left subtree then to the right subtree. For Post order, you traverse from the left subtree to the right subtree then to the … WebFeb 18, 2024 · In the tree data structure, traversal means visiting nodes in some specific manner. There are nodes2 types of traversals. Generally, this kind of traversal is based on the binary tree. A binary tree means each node can have a maximum of 2 nodes. A binary tree is a well-known data structure. There’s also a Binary Search tree (BST).

WebDec 1, 2024 · Let us print all of the nodes in the above binary tree using the preorder traversal. First, we will start from the root node and print its value i.e. 50. After that we … WebTo define a binary tree, the possibility that only one of the children may be empty must be acknowledged. An artifact, which in some textbooks is called an extended binary tree, is …

WebDec 1, 2024 · Preorder traversal of the binary tree is: 50 ,20 ,11 ,22 ,53 ,52 ,78 , You can observe that the code gives the same output that we have derived while discussing this algorithm. Conclusion In this article, we have discussed and implemented the preorder tree traversal algorithm in Python.

WebApr 3, 2024 · Drawing Binary Tree from inorder and preorder Ask Question Asked 11 months ago Modified 11 months ago Viewed 378 times 0 In-order traversal: 24,17,32,18,51,11,26,39,43 Pre-order traversal: 11,32,24,17,51,18,43,26,39 The question asked to find which nodes belong on the right subtree of the root node. bitbucket limitationsWebThis tool helps to resolve that. You can either input the tree array given by binarysearch, or create your own tree and copy it to binarysearch as a test case. The resulting tree is both pannable and zoomable. NOTE: The binarysearch website has since implemented a visualization for binary trees. Though this means this web app is no longer ... bitbucket link to line of codeWebGiven two integer arrays preorderand inorderwhere preorderis the preorder traversal of a binary tree and inorderis the inorder traversal of the same tree, construct and return the binary tree. Example 1: Input:preorder = … darwin careers expobitbucket list repos in projectWebA Binary Search Tree (BST) is a binary tree in which each vertex has only up to 2 children that satisfies BST property: All vertices in the left subtree of a vertex must hold a value smaller than its own and all vertices in the … bitbucket list all repositories curlWebConstruct a binary tree from inorder and preorder traversal. Write an efficient algorithm to construct a binary tree from the given inorder and preorder sequence. For example, … bitbucket local hostingWebIn this article we will learn three Depth first traversals namely inorder, preorder and postorder and their use. These three types of traversals generally used in different types of binary tree. In summary: Inorder: left, … bitbucket link to commit